Abstract

The utility model discloses an electrostatic induction demonstration motor, which belongs to an electrics teaching aid; the utility model aims at providing a device which can visually, visibly, and interestingly demonstrate the electrostatic induction phenomenon. The utility model comprises a rotor; an insulated rotor (1) is installed on a casing (3) provided with a high voltage generator (4) inside through a fixed axle (6), a positive discharge needle (2) and a negative discharge needle (5) extending from the casing (3) are respectively connected with the positive electrode and the negative electrode of the high voltage generator (4) and are arranged in misplacement and opposite direction along the tangential line direction of the rotor (1). The utility model can interestingly and visually demonstrate the physical phenomenon that an object with high voltage static generates the electrostatic induction to peripheral objects to lead the students to well master the relative knowledge through interesting experiments, therefore, the purpose of improving teaching quality and popularizing scientific popular knowledge can be realized; the utility model is the ideal electrics teaching aid.

Description

Electrostatic induction demonstration motor
Technical field:
The utility model relates to a kind of physics teaching or science popularization apparatus for demonstrating, relates in particular to a kind of device that is used to demonstrate the electrostatic induction phenomenon.
Background technology:
As everyone knows, the object that has high-pressure electrostatic can make its identical static of object induction polarization on every side, and this physical phenomenon is the important content in physics teaching in secondary school or the Popular Science Education.How image, reflect that above-mentioned physical phenomenon is the technical matters that current physics teaching or Popular Science Education should solve intuitively, enjoyably.
Summary of the invention:
At the above-mentioned defective that exists in the prior art, the utility model aim to provide a kind of can image, demonstrate the electrostatic induction demonstration motor that high-pressure electrostatic exerts an influence to object on every side intuitively, enjoyably.
To achieve these goals, the utility model by the following technical solutions: it comprises rotor; The rotor of insulation is installed on the machine box that inside is provided with high pressure generator by dead axle, stretches out in the positive spray point that is connected with the high pressure generator positive and negative electrode, the negative spray point slave box respectively and arranges opposite to each other along the tangential direction dislocation of rotor.
Compared with the prior art, the utility model is owing to utilized the principle that the electric charge same sex is repelled each other, there is a natural attraction between the sexes dexterously, the object of therefore can be vividly, having a high-pressure electrostatic to student's demonstration intuitively can produce the physical phenomenon of electrostatic induction to object around it, make the student grasp relevant knowledge better, thereby reach the purpose of improving the quality of teaching and promoting popular science knowledge by directly perceived, interesting experiment.
Description of drawings:
Fig. 1 is a structural representation of the present utility model;
Fig. 2 is the vertical view of Fig. 1.
Among the figure: rotor 1 positive spray point 2 machine boxes 3 high pressure generators 4 negative spray point 5 dead axles 6
Embodiment:
The utility model is described in further detail below in conjunction with accompanying drawing and specific embodiment:
In Fig. 1~2: the rotor 1 of insulation is installed on the machine box 3 by dead axle 6, and rotor 1 can freely rotate around dead axle 5; Be provided with high pressure generator 4 in machine box 3, the positive spray point 2 that is connected with high pressure generator 4 positive poles, the negative spray point 5 that is connected with high pressure generator 4 negative poles stretch out in the slave box 3 respectively, and the needle point of two pins points to rotor 1.In order to increase torque, the needle point of above-mentioned two pins is arranged in opposite directions along the tangential direction dislocation ground of rotor 1.For weight reduction, rotor 1 can adopt the object such as classes such as Disposable paper cup or plastic cups.
Principle of work: when opening high pressure generator 4, positive spray point 2, negative spray point 5 are with high-pressure electrostatic immediately, will respond to and gather the identical static charge of a large amount of polarity on the surface of rotor 1 near the position of two needle points simultaneously, according to the principle that the electric charge same sex is repelled each other, there is a natural attraction between the sexes, rotor 1 rotates under the effect of charge force.
